Extra Bula FC head coach Stephane Auvray says the team is focusing on improving in the final third as they prepare to take on Vanuatu United FC in their OFC Pro League match tomorrow in Melbourne.

While Bula FC struggled with consistency early in the competition, winning just one of their first five matches, Auvray says that although the team is creating chances, they must start scoring goals.

Bula FC will play all three of their Melanesian neighbours in Melbourne.

Meanwhile, Bula FC will take on Vanuatu United FC tomorrow at 1pm in Melbourne, Australia.

The team will then face Hekari United next Wednesday at 8pm, followed by Solomon FC next Saturday at 7.30pm.

They will round off the circuit with their Round 1 postponed match against South Island United FC on 8th March at 8pm.
